Our Collection


Chalet Pescosta
Chalet Pescosta
Bedrooms: 6 Bedrooms
Sleeps: Sleeps 12
Read More
Chalet Della Valle
Chalet Della Valle
Bedrooms: 4 Bedrooms
Sleeps: Sleeps 8
Read More
Villa Ventura
Villa Ventura
Bedrooms: 7 Bedrooms
Sleeps: Sleeps 14
Read More
Villa Lansbury
Villa Lansbury
Bedrooms: 6 Bedrooms
Sleeps: Sleeps 12
Read More
Villa Bell
Villa Bell
Bedrooms: 5 Bedrooms
Sleeps: Sleeps 10
Read More
Villa Dench
Villa Dench
Bedrooms: 7 Bedrooms
Sleeps: Sleeps 14
Read More
Villa Watts
Villa Watts
Bedrooms: 5 Bedrooms
Sleeps: Sleeps 10
Read More
Villa Kidman
Villa Kidman
Bedrooms: 6 Bedrooms, Six bedroom luxury villa France
Sleeps: Sleeps 12
Read More
Villa Whale
Villa Whale
Bedrooms: 3 Bedrooms
Sleeps: Sleeps 7
Read More
Villa Coover
Villa Coover
Bedrooms: 3 Bedrooms
Sleeps: Sleeps 8
Read More
Villa Blumberg
Villa Blumberg
Bedrooms: 4 Bedrooms
Sleeps: Sleeps 8
Read More
Villa Howe
Villa Howe
Bedrooms: 4 Bedrooms
Sleeps: Sleeps 8
Read More
Villa Fury
Villa Fury
Bedrooms: 6 Bedrooms
Sleeps: Sleeps 12
Read More
Villa Toad
Villa Toad
Bedrooms: 4 Bedrooms
Sleeps: Sleeps 10
Read More
Villa Sealion
Villa Sealion
Bedrooms: 5 Bedrooms
Sleeps: Sleeps 11
Read More